Under-Temperature (UT) Warning
WARNING:
Risk of
equipment damage, personal
injury
or
death.
Some
troubleshooting procedures require you to
perform
work inside the electrical enclosure with the power
on.
Follow electrical safety procedures and observe all high-voltage
indicators.
Refer
to Electrical
Safety
During Troubleshooting
and Opening
and Closing the Electrical Enclosure before
performing any troubleshooting procedure.
1.
Press
the CLEAR FAULTS key and wait for the system
to
return
to
the system-ready state.
2.
lf
the
warning disappears and the unit appears to be working again,
the
voltage to the unit may have temporarily sagged or you may have
an intermittent
problem. Repetitive warnings
in
the same zone
indicate
a problem with the circuitry
in
that zone
ot
an
intermittent
RTD
failure.
Take the
following steps to troubleshoot intermittent
under-temperature warnings:
a.
Check
for
a
change in environmental conditions, such as added
ventilation or sources of
drafts.
A cold
draft can keep your unit,
hoses, and guns
from heating.
b.
Make sure
the power is turned on at your branch circuit disconnect
switch and that your power supply is supplying the proper voltage
to
the unit.
c.
Check all hose and gun electrical
plugs.
Make sure
the
connections are tight and free of corrosion.
